Is Woodland Safe?

No — this is a high-crime area. Woodland in Washington, DC has a safety grade of D-. The overall crime index is 168, which is 68% above the national average of 100.

Compared to the Washington average (crime index 105), Woodland is 63% higher in overall crime. Residents and visitors should exercise extra caution in this area, particularly after dark.

Looking at specific crime types, rape is the most elevated concern (index: 177, 77% above average), while burglary is the lowest risk (index: 90). Violent crime is a particular area of concern relative to property crime in this neighborhood.
